Obsidian Sync: Cannot open email support link

Steps to reproduce

Go to Sync settings and click this “Email support” button.

Expected result

A mailto: link is automatically opened, or a confirmation popup appears with a clickable button in it.

Actual result

There appears a very long popup containing a mailto: link with a URL-encoded debug info.

The popup is so long that the “Open the link” button completely goes outside my screen, so I can’t press it.

Additional information

I do know how I can solve this issue.

  1. Insert an email link (that is short enough) in a note
[Email](mailto:[email protected])
  1. Click it, and turn on “Always open mailto: links in the future”, and then click “Open this link”

But I just wanted to let you know about this problem.

I don’t think it’s really a “bug” but I suspect it is something unexpected.
